Welcome to Deaf Aotearoa NZ, your beacon of hope and support in Auckland and beyond. Established with a vision for a vibrant, inclusive New Zealand, we've been at the heart of the Deaf community for many years, fostering connections and championing rights. Our journey began as an organisation dedicated to Hauora, or well-being, for all members of the Deaf and hard of hearing community. From employment support to youth services, first signs classes, advocacy, and information and resources on Deaf Culture and New Zealand Sign Language (NZSL), we've been there every step of the way. Our iSign Interpreting Service is more than just a language bridge; it's a symbol of our commitment to ensure that everyone in the Deaf community can communicate effectively, breaking down barriers and opening up opportunities.
